Understanding Core Risks in Cloud Computing Environments
Cloud computing introduces unique vulnerabilities that traditional IT frameworks often overlook. Data exposure, service outages, compliance breaches, and insider threats form the backbone of potential risks. Without robust controls, organizations face heightened exposure to financial losses and reputational damage. The distributed nature of cloud services amplifies exposure points—from misconfigured storage buckets to unpatched virtual machines. These vulnerabilities thrive when governance is reactive rather than strategic. By shifting focus from perimeter defense to zero-trust principles, organizations gain greater control over access privileges and data flows.
Compliance adds another layer of complexity. Regulatory landscapes such as GDPR, HIPAA, and CCPA impose strict requirements on data handling and breach disclosure. Failure to align cloud strategies with legal mandates invites penalties and operational disruptions. Moreover, supply chain dependencies introduce hidden risks—third-party vendors may carry latent vulnerabilities or weak security postures that compromise entire ecosystems. A single compromised component can cascade into widespread outages or data leaks. Key Components of an Effective Risk Management Framework
An effective strategy relies on several interdependent elements:
- Risk Assessment: Identify threats using threat modeling tools specific to cloud workloads.
- Risk Prioritization: Rank exposures by impact and likelihood using quantitative scoring models.
- Mitigation Planning: Develop targeted controls—encryption, access tiering, redundancy mechanisms—tailored to identified risks.
- Continuous Monitoring: Deploy automated detection systems for anomalous behavior across compute, storage, and network layers.
- Incident Response: Establish clear playbooks for rapid containment and recovery during breaches or service failures.

The human element remains critical despite technological advances. Employee awareness programs reduce errors such as accidental data leaks or phishing susceptibility—common entry points exploited by adversaries.
